simms Posted April 16, 2021 Share Posted April 16, 2021 RIP Virtual Desktop https://www.oculus.com/blog/introducing-oculus-air-link-a-wireless-way-to-play-pc-vr-games-on-oculus-quest-2-plus-infinite-office-updates-support-for-120-hz-on-quest-2-and-more/ Quote OCULUS AIR LINK COMING SOON TO QUEST 2 IN EXPERIMENTAL MODE Note: Air Link is part of v28, but it requires that both your headset and PC be running v28 software. That means we’ll unlock Air Link once both Quest and PC v28 releases are rolled out. Since launching in 2019 and exiting beta last year, Oculus Link has been a widely used feature across the Quest Platform. With a gaming PC and a compatible USB-C cable, Link has given people access to Rift’s impressive content library, including games like Asgard’s Wrath, Lone Echo, Stormland, and more. But of course, being tethered to your PC can break immersion and limit your mobility. We know gamers want to use Link without a wire—to experience the full freedom of movement offered by Quest 2 while playing the high-end titles that can only run on a gaming PC. That’s why we’ve been working on a new streaming technology called Oculus Air Link—a completely wireless way to play PC VR content on Quest 2 using WiFi, built on the successful Oculus Link streaming pipeline. klargon Posted April 17, 2021 Share Posted April 17, 2021 I also have a 5700xt. This is from the Oculus Air Link FAQ: Max bit rate values for AMD and NVIDIA GPUs are different - You can set up to a max of 100 mbps on AMD - You can set up to a max of 200 mbps on NVIDIA Not to say that won’t change over time, but they’ll need to offer different encoding if they’re to improve it. papalazarou Posted April 24, 2021 Share Posted April 24, 2021 12 hours ago, papalazarou said: oculus airlink is offically going live today - oculus just annouced on twitter - the message said quests and pc on v28 - it didnt say just quest 2 so this may be also going live for quest 1 as well - will find out later update on this - unfort still no offical quest 1 support for Oculus Air......BUT using the unoffical work arround i posted earlier does work on quest 1 unlocking Oculus Air. Had a play about with it and at first it was un playable latency was so bad that there was 3-4 second wait between any action you did and it registering (ie waving hands) but after reading arround i found the answer - in the oculus debug tool set encode birate to 0 - after that it worked great. finally able to play minecraft bedrock wirelessly. Tried Half Life Alyx and again it worked great ( i found personally the link cable esp in steam games was woefull so stuck to VD for them). 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Moz Posted April 27, 2021 Share Posted April 27, 2021 I was having terrible problems with my Quest lenses fogging up when I put them on. I've found a brilliant solution! We all know it's down to temperature causing condensation. So now I simply keep my Quest on top of my desktop PC, which has an exhaust blowing upward out of the case. The lenses are always just above room temperature and no longer fog up when I put the Quest on my big dumb head. Nice!
